transfer Inernet service/TV temporarily

Our family is going to move out from the home to another place for renovation around 3 months. We hope to transfer the current Telus Internet/TV to the new place for 3 months and tranfer back after the renovation. How I can do?

    I’m going to suggest you get a vacation disconnect at your current home, and buy a temporary, full price service at your short-term place. “Transferring” usually ends up being a cancellation and reconnect, which you would need to do twice, and you may lose benefits you currently have, or need to pay a cancellation fee. Ensure anyone you speak with understands your needs, so you aren’t surprised.
